    Mesothelioma Settlements and Mesothelioma Lawyers

    Asbestos lawyers are dedicated to helping victims and families receive the financial compensation they are entitled to. These attorneys are employed by national companies with access to asbestos databases and a track record of obtaining important cases and settlements.

    They assist patients with mesothelioma to file a personal injury lawsuit or wrongful death suit against the companies who exposed them. Most of these claims are settled prior to trial.

    In many cases, the attorneys of a mesothelioma sufferer will make a claim against multiple defendants. This is because it's often difficult to pinpoint the exact company that was responsible for the mesothelioma that a person was diagnosed with. It could be that different asbestos manufacturers and employers exposed the victim to asbestos.

    Asbestos lawyers are also able to assist their clients with filing mesothelioma trust funds claims. These funds are created when asbestos-related companies go bankrupt due to bankruptcy laws in their state. The trusts are worth more than $30 billion available to asbestos victims.

    Getting the financial help you require

    Finding the financial help you need can help reduce your anxiety during treatment, pay for medical expenses and help you meet your financial goals. Compensation for mesothelioma can assist in paying for future and past medical expenses as well as legal costs, lost income and earning capacity loss as well as discomfort and pain and other damages. The amount you can receive depends on your state and mesothelioma type. There are three kinds of mesothelioma lawsuits that include personal injury, wrongful deaths, and trust fund claims. A personal injury lawsuit seeks compensation from the party responsible for your condition. This is the most common mesothelioma lawsuit. The wrongful death claim is filed by family members of mesothelioma patients and seek compensation from the company or companies responsible for the victim's death. A mesothelioma trust fund claim is filed with one of the numerous asbestos trust funds that have been established by the government or private asbestos companies.

    Many victims of asbestos have suffered for decades because asbestos manufacturers concealed the dangers of their products. They knew asbestos was harmful and caused death, yet they continued to use asbestos in their homes, buildings, ships and automobiles. Many of these businesses have been declared bankrupt and their assets have been put into trust funds. These trust funds provide money to mesothelioma victims as well as asbestosis patients and other asbestos-related diseases.
